- New simulation shows: Supercell thunderstorms are becoming more frequent in Europe and causing severe damage through hail, wind and rain.
- The Alpine region and parts of Central and Eastern Europe are particularly affected, while south-western France is experiencing a decline.
- Although supercells account for only a small proportion of all thunderstorms, they are posing increasing challenges for infrastructure and society.
Rising temperatures intensify supercell thunderstorms in Europe
